It what has always been a tough match its vital to get a good start, and the boys did just that. We raced into a 3 - 0 lead before Northants got a frame on the board. We then took another 3 in a row to got 6 - 1 up. Northants rallied a little but we managed to take the first section 8 - 3.
4/4 - Luke Mills, Jamie Hobby & Vivek Makh
 
3/4 - Phil Parkin 
The second section saw Northants come out firing on all cylinders but the lads took it in their stride as they shared frames. But Northants eventually took the section 6 - 5.

The third section was more of the same as again Northants edge it 6 - 5 despite all the lads performing well But we weren't at panic stations just yet as we still lead 18 - 15.

In the fourth and final sections the lads were back on form taking it 6 -5 with Vivek Makh on cue to take the wining frame. All in all a good team performance. Well done Lads!!!

After the defeat to the 'A' side in the first fixture of the year the boys second match of the season came against a vey solid Northants line up.
The lads started well with Steve Emms and Mathew Peel putting us 2 - 1 up. But Northants hit back taking 7 of the next 8 frames with only James Willis on cue for the Bears. So even with the score line 8 - 3 to Northants after the first section we knew if the lads could settle down and take their chances we were still in with a shout. 
The second section started well with Mathew Peel & James Willis winning again, Northants hit back but wins from M.Meaney, Josh Griffiths, T.Woolman, D. Earles & Steve Martin saw us take the section 7 - 4, to make it 12 - 10 to Northants at Half - Time.
